Choosing an auto repair shop in Port St Joe comes down to trust, transparency, and turnaround time. The strongest shops explain the diagnosis in plain language, show you the worn or failed part, and put a written estimate in front of you before any work begins. Look for ASE-certified technicians, a posted labor rate, and a clear warranty on both parts and labor — most reputable Port St Joe-area shops back their work for at least 12 months or 12,000 miles.
Price matters, but the lowest quote is not always the best value. A slightly higher estimate that uses quality parts, includes a labor warranty, and comes from a shop with strong reviews will usually cost less over the life of the repair. When you request quotes through The Auto Network, ask each shop to itemize parts versus labor so you are comparing the same scope of work rather than just a bottom-line figure.
It also pays to think about the relationship, not just the single repair. A shop that documents your vehicle history, reminds you about upcoming maintenance, and does not pressure you into work you do not need is worth keeping. Florida heat and humidity are hard on batteries, belts, hoses, and A/C systems, so a Port St Joe shop that knows the local driving environment can help you stay ahead of common failures.
